Deaths of Brainerd middle schoolers prompt calls to address bullying, mental health

The tragic deaths of two middle school students in Brainerd, Minnesota, have sparked a significant dialogue about bullying and mental health within the community. Ava Starr, aged 11, and 13-year-old Alexis Thornton both passed away within a short span of three weeks, with their families attributing their struggles to bullying from peers. This heartbreaking situation has not only led to grief for their families but has also raised urgent questions about the support systems in place for young people facing such challenges. In the wake of these events, the community has come together to honor the memories of the girls. Flowers, photographs, and heartfelt messages have been placed outside Alexis's home, symbolizing the love and support from friends and neighbors. This collective mourning has prompted discussions about the need for greater awareness and intervention regarding bullying and mental health issues in schools. As the community reflects on these losses, there is a growing call for action to ensure that such tragedies do not recur. Parents, educators, and local leaders are urged to collaborate in creating a safer and more supportive environment for all students, emphasizing the importance of mental health resources and anti-bullying initiatives.
